Gene drive innovation under advancement by University of Adelaide to fight intrusive mice numbers

Researchers at the University of Adelaide have actually launched their findings about the possible efficiency of gene drive innovation to manage intrusive mice.

Key points:

  • A South Australian research study group determines brand-new innovation it hopes will ultimately suppress mice numbers

  • Co-author Luke Gierus states the innovation is the very first possible hereditary biocontrol tool for intrusive mammals

  • Researchers think the innovation can be established to work versus other intrusive insects

The innovation– called t-CRISPR– utilizes advanced computer system modelling on lab mice.

DNA innovation is utilized to make modifications to a female fertility gene and, as soon as the population is filled with the genetic engineering, the women that are created will be sterile.

Research paper co-first author and post-graduate trainee Luke Gierus stated the innovation was the very first hereditary biological control tool for intrusive animals.

” So we can do a preliminary seeding of a couple hundred mice which will suffice, in theory, to spread out and remove a whole population,” he stated.

” We’ve done some modelling in this paper and we’ve revealed utilizing this system we can launch 256 mice into a population of 200,000 on an island which would get rid of those 200,000 in about 25 years.”

Paper co-author Luke Gierus states the innovation has a long method to go however indications are appealing.( Supplied: Luke Gierus)

The group has actually been carrying out the research study for 5 years.

Mr Gierus stated the next action would be to continue screening in labs prior to launching mice onto islands where the group might securely keep track of the impacts.

He stated the technique was much more gentle than other approaches, such as baiting.

” It’s possibly a brand-new tool that can either be utilized together with the existing innovation or by itself,” Mr Gierus stated.

” This is rather an advanced innovation that offers us another method to attempt and manage and reduce mice.”

Farmers group invites research study

Grain Producers South Australia ceo Brad Perry stated presented mouse types might significantly harm crops and devices, and current plagues had actually been damaging.

” When it concerns insects and illness in grain and farming more broadly, we require to be ingenious and believe outside the square on avoidance procedures,” Mr Perry stated.

He stated innovation such as this might assist farmers conserve cash in the long run.

Invasive mice types can have a destructive effect on crops.( Supplied: Michael Vincent)

” Grain manufacturers presently handle populations by reducing the food source at harvest, and if populations need [it] zinc phosphide baits are utilized,” Mr Perry stated.

” However, utilizing baits contributes to input expenses, it is not constantly easily offered and there are minimal windows to when this works.”

Mr Perry stated numerous farmers would be eager to see the innovation in the future.

” We are helpful of extra tools that help in reducing presented mouse populations– especially when it includes regional world-leading research study at the University of Adelaide– which is targeted, lowers inputs and is sustainable.”
